I just checked, and 1994/95 was a 10 team Premier League, so a little bit less margin for error I suppose. It did though have the likes of Partick Thistle and Falkirk in it, and as you say it beggars belief that Aberdeen and United, with such an array of players, fought it out to see who was relegated. I notice that Celtic were utter dovers that season, finishing 4th in the league, only 3 points ahead of Falkirk. I'd like to say that Aberdeen learned the lesson of that season....that no team was 'too big' to go down....but we didn't. 5 years later we finished bottom on only 33 points (a figure we're on target to match at this point in time). For those amongst us that are too young to remember these halcyon days, a more pertinent reminder of how quickly a crash can come to virtually any team would be Kilmarnock. 3rd in the league and celebrating like they'd beaten Barcelona, then 2 years later it's Arbroath and Morton. 0 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
